01 / Why we exist

Most real estate advice is unverifiable at the moment you must act on it.

A client hires once every seven to ten years, never observes the outcome the property would have had under different advice, and cannot separate a good decision from a rising market. So the work gets judged on presentation rather than on whether it was right.

We work the other way. Every engagement produces something inspectable before you commit — the evidence behind the recommendation, the carry math, the buyers by origin, and the plan that changes if the market disagrees with us. You can check it in advance and audit it afterward.

06 / How an engagement runs

Scoped to a decision, agreed before it starts.

Four steps and a written scope, agreed before the work begins.

1.

The question

A conversation to establish what decision is actually being made, and what would have to be true for the answer to change.

2.

The scope

A written scope naming the deliverable, the evidence it will rest on, and the timeline.

3.

The work

Research, model, and written findings — including the cases where the honest answer is that the deal does not work.

4.

Execution

Where wanted, the same evidence carries into positioning, launch, and representation through closing.
